Bean to Cup Coffee Machines

The best bean-to-cup coffee machines allow you to prepare your favorite drinks at the click of a button. They let you control key aspects like the temperature, grind size, and much more.

Certain models have a separate milk container that allows you to separate the storage of milk and avoiding the need for an additional manual texturizing process. Other models have built-in milk frothers that can heat and froth at the touch of a button.

Adjustable Grinder Setting

A bean-to-cup machine lets you customize your coffee experience. This is possible because of several adjustable settings, including grind size. The size of the grind is a key element in how your coffee will taste and can impact things like flavor and texture. Depending on your preferences, you may want to go with an espresso with a finer grind or a coarser grind for filter coffee. A best bean to cup machine will also have a variety of grind options so that you can play around with your favorite blends, without needing to buy coffee beans.

Adjustable Temperature Controls

Bean to cup machines are calibrated to create excellent tasting, high-quality brews at the press of a single button. In essence, they combine an espresso maker as well as a coffee grinder and a milk frother in one unit - although they can be bulky and expensive. They're especially appealing to those who enjoy cappuccinos, lattes and mugs filled with hot hard, stiff milk.

philips-4300-series-bean-to-cup-espresso-machine-lattego-milk-frother-8-coffee-variaties-intuitive-display-black-ep4346-70-1847.jpgThe top bean-to-cup coffee machines come with temperature controls that can be adjusted. This helps to give you an excellent cup of espresso every time. You can determine the ideal temperature for a specific type of coffee, and also alter the grind size, depending on your preference. If you like your filter coffee with a more fine grind, for example, the right adjustments can make all the difference.

Texturizing the milk is yet another possibility you can accomplish with a good bean-to-cup machine. This lets you get the foamy, frothy drinks popular in cafes. Most home coffee makers cannot do this and so finding one that can is a huge bonus.

One-Touch Cleaning Functions

The top bean-to-cup machines come with one-touch cleaning features that help keep their machines running smoothly. This feature stops the build-up of mineral deposits that could impact the quality of your coffee. The more frequently you clean your coffee machine the more efficient its performance will be. Find models with a water reservoir that is convenient, waste bin and drip tray for easy cleaning. It is also an excellent idea to choose the model with an integrated descaling function.

A bean to cup machine is a little more complicated than a pod coffee maker, but it offers more control over the final product. It's the perfect option for those who like to play around with different kinds of beans and want to create unique drinks that aren't readily available in stores. Some models come with a built in grinder which allows you to grind fresh beans at home.

One-touch cleaning options also make these kinds of machines more user-friendly. A lot of them have automatic shut-offs, so you don't have to be concerned about not turning them off when you finish making. They also have a detachable brewing unit that makes it easier to take off and clean the filter basket, carafe, and the brew head. There are also models that have self-cleaning modes, which reduces the risk of a messy coffee spill.

Programmable Settings

While the name suggests the machine is automated that makes coffee beans, a bean-to cup maker actually requires a certain amount of user interaction. This type of machine combines an espresso machine and coffee grinder, a milk frother, and various other components into one unit. It lets you make various drinks without having to use the individual components. A good bean-to-cup coffee maker will let you adjust the brewing options as well as select the best grind settings so that you can get the perfect drink every time.

The majority of bean-to-cup coffee machines provide a variety of drinks like cappuccino, espresso, and lattes. If you want a more extensive menu, look into an option that has additional settings for creating more specialized drinks, such as Latte or iced coffee. A lot of models have adjustable grinder settings that allow you to alter the coarseness of your beans to meet different brewing techniques and taste preferences.

If you're looking to spice up their morning coffee, a model with a built-in steamer or milk frother could be utilized. This lets you make cafe-style coffees like flat whites and cappuccinos. You can also choose from various sizes of drip tray to accommodate a variety of cups and mugs using the best bean-to cup coffee machine.

Some models also provide adjustable temperature controls for water which is ideal for those who prefer a colder drink. Also, if you're concerned about the environmental impact of your coffee maker choose a model with a recyclable filter.
